Output 89f7be5d82016b18dbf6faeefdcffa711d1d1edbd4ef68ae06fccd20e2c069af:132

value
349054
script pubkey
OP_0 OP_PUSHBYTES_20 8fcd4bcfb99b48f0e8ee144756ce6f59645d3444
address
bc1q3lx5hnaendy0p68wz3r4dnn0t9j96dzyxw7eza
transaction
89f7be5d82016b18dbf6faeefdcffa711d1d1edbd4ef68ae06fccd20e2c069af
confirmations
1845
spent
true